Deutsch: Region Frankfurt, 1893: Bad Homburg und Umgebung. Man beachte die damals in Homburg in einem Kopfbahnhof endende Eisenbahn. Das Dorf am rechten Bildrand ist Ober-Erlenbach.
English: Frankfurt region, 1893: Homburg and vicinity. The small town on Frankfurt's northern outskirts, today one of the city's most expensive suburbs, was the capital of a tiny principality until the mid-19th century.
